  • What is the best itinerary to experience the Gili Islands, Indonesia?

    A typical itinerary might involve spending 3-4 days, with one day on each island. Start on Gili Trawangan, known for its vibrant nightlife and range of accommodation. Then, head to Gili Meno for its tranquil atmosphere and beautiful beaches, perfect for relaxation. Finally, explore Gili Air, appreciating its laid-back vibe and fantastic snorkelling spots. Consider island hopping via boat; it's a scenic way to travel.

  • What is the recommended daily budget for the Gili Islands, Indonesia (accommodation, dining, transportation, and activities)?

    A daily budget of £50-£150 per person is realistic, depending on your preferences. This covers budget-friendly to mid-range accommodation, local eateries (warungs) for meals, boat trips between islands, and various activities like snorkelling or diving. Luxury options will significantly increase this figure.

  • What is the best time to visit the Gili Islands, Indonesia?

    The dry season, from May to October, offers the best weather for visiting the Gili Islands. Expect sunshine, low humidity, and minimal rainfall. However, this is also peak season, so expect higher prices and more crowds.

  • What traditional local food should you try in the Gili Islands, Indonesia?

    Indonesian cuisine is diverse. In the Gilis, you'll find fresh seafood dishes, Nasi Goreng (fried rice), Mie Goreng (fried noodles), Gado-Gado (vegetable salad with peanut sauce), and Sate (grilled skewers of meat). Many warungs (small restaurants) offer delicious and affordable options.

  • What should visitors know about the weather and natural risks in the Gili Islands, Indonesia?

    The Gilis experience a tropical climate. Expect high humidity and temperatures, particularly during the wet season. The main natural risk is strong currents, especially around Gili Trawangan. Always heed any warnings from locals or lifeguards when swimming or snorkelling.
  • Are there any special items you’ll need when travelling to the Gili Islands, Indonesia?

    Pack light, breathable clothing suitable for hot and humid weather. Sunscreen, a hat, and sunglasses are essential. Reef-safe sunscreen is preferable to protect the coral. Bring swimwear, a waterproof bag, and comfortable walking shoes. Insect repellent is also recommended.
